Reported incidence of gaming system faults
This data is taken from reports made to us by licensees. Licensees are required to report any such faults to us as a key event as a condition of their licence.
The aim of our regulatory activity is to see the number of gaming system faults reduce. However, reports are also an indication of effective monitoring of the performance of games so further work is required to develop this metric.
Incidences of gaming system faults reported to the Gambling Commission - 2024 quarterly breakdown
Key event type | January 2024 to March 2024 | April 2024 to June 2024 | July 2024 to September 2024 | October 2024 to December 2024 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Number of reported game faults to the Commission |
85 | 54 | 45 | 160 |
Incidences of gaming system faults reported to the Commission – annual breakdown
Key event type | Year to December 2021 | Year to December 2022 | Year to December 2023 | Year to December 2024 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Number of reported game faults to the Commission |
229 | 270 | 194 | 344 |
